Launch Plan: Bramblewick Teas "Hearthside" Range — Managers Only

Branch managers, here's the rundown. Hearthside launches the first week of autumn with three blends and in-store tasting stations. Fixtures arrive two weeks prior; Dena's team handles merchandising guides. Staff training is a 30-minute module, mandatory before launch day. Early-bird promo runs ten days. Keep displays near the front tills. Rollout timing ties to the plan noted below.

management briefing: The renewal with Zoraelax Group closes at $10 million a year, 15 percent below the last contract. Project Ralael slips by six weeks because of the audit delay.

Handover: Fennelrun cold starts. Handlers in the batch tier spike to ~6s after idle periods; warm pool covers peak hours only. If customers report slow first requests outside 08:00–20:00, that's expected — log it, don't escalate. Tuning work lands next sprint. Known-issue matrix and canned responses are on the internal page.

runbook for hawif-tajeg: https://grafana.plorvasoft.example/dash

## CI Note — Bloomgate Filter Stage Failures

Security review context: the Bloomgate stage seeds a bloom filter in front of the Kestrel KV store before integration tests run. Intermittent failures here are almost always a stale filter snapshot, not a membership-logic bug. The pipeline rejects snapshots older than 24 hours by design; do not override this check. If a run fails, confirm the snapshot timestamp in the stage log and cross-reference the build token recorded below.

build token for bahap-kajeg: htk4_cda4

## Step 4: Switch the CSV Import Wizard

Alright, this is the fiddly one. The new wizard in Grainloft validates headers up front instead of failing halfway through, so any old imports relying on silent column-skipping will now error loudly — that's intentional. Flip the feature flag per tenant, not globally, and keep the legacy path around for one release. Once the flag is on, the wizard reads its settings from the values below.

settings of fafog-haduf:
ZORIX_PIN=4648
ZORIX_METRICS_HOST=metrics.zorix.paliqsys.corp
ZORIX_LOG_LEVEL=info
ZORIX_TENANT=druix